Scott Ritter says "We are sleep walking to disaster"

   

Scott Ritter

 

Published on May 21, 2022

#ukrainewar #warinukraine #russiavsukraine #russiaukraineconflict #ukraine #russiavsukraine #russiaukraineconflict #war #russia


  AutoPlay Next Video